cocosCreator實現《點我+1》小遊戲

      所用cocosCreator版本:2.0.9

      編程語言:javaScript

1.新建空白項目,資源目錄創建main.js     Main.fire

2.在main場景下創建各種節點結構如下圖:

3.編寫代碼main.js


cc.Class({
    extends: cc.Component,

    properties: {
        score:cc.Label,
        
    },

    // onLoad () {},

    start () {
        //初始化分數
        this.score.string = '0';
    },

    onClickAdd(){
        console.log('點擊按鈕前按鈕的值爲:'+this.score.string);
        this.score.string = (Number(this.score.string) + 1).toString();
        console.log('點擊按鈕後分數爲:'+ this.score.string);
    },
    // update (dt) {},

});

4.掛載腳本

點擊main場景下的canves節點,在右側屬性檢查器最下面,點擊添加組件按鈕,選擇用戶腳本組件,選擇Main,將場景下的Score節點拖到腳本組件的score框中,完成掛載。如下圖:

5.綁定點擊事件

單擊Button節點,在屬性檢查器中將Click Events  的值 改爲1,將canvas節點拖到第一個框中,第二個框下拉選擇Main,第三個框中選擇 onClickAdd,Ctrl+s  保存一下場景。運行,點擊按鈕:

這樣就實現了點擊按鈕Lable加1的需求。

有需要服務器的小夥伴可以點擊下面鏈接5折購買哦~

熱賣雲產品3折起,雲服務器、雲數據庫特惠,服務更穩,速度更快,價格更優
https://cloud.tencent.com/act/cps/redirect?redirect=1014&cps_key=f960a09f2d06453a8d42a2063b49abc2&from=console

熱賣雲產品3折起,雲服務器、雲數據庫特惠,服務更穩,速度更快,價格更優
https://cloud.tencent.com/act/cps/redirect?redirect=1014&cps_key=f960a09f2d06453a8d42a2063b49abc2&from=console

騰訊雲服務器安全可靠高性能,多種配置5折出售:
https://cloud.tencent.com/act/cps/redirect?redirect=1001&cps_key=f960a09f2d06453a8d42a2063b49abc2&from=console

 

本人由此開發的小遊戲《別點奇數》,就是沿用此計分方式統計的。歡迎體驗:

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章